How our sorting works

The order in which job vacancies are displayed is determined by a composite score based on the following factors:

  • Keyword Relevance: How well your search terms match the vacancy details. We prioritize matches found in the job title, followed by job requirements, location names, and educational levels. Matches within general employer information or the organization's name carry a lower weight.
  • Commercial Prioritization (Premium Jobs): Vacancies paid for by employers ('Premium' or 'Sponsored') receive a ranking boost and will appear higher in the search results.
  • Recency (Date Relevance): Newer vacancies are prioritized. The relevance score of a vacancy is reduced by half once the posting is older than 30 days.
  • Proximity (Distance Relevance): Vacancies located closer to your search location are ranked higher. For vacancies located more than 30 km from the search center, the relevance score is halved.
The final ranking is established by multiplying all these individual factors to calculate the total relevance score.

    Job description

    We are brave, we are ambitious, we are honest, and we are Citizen!

    With over fifty years of experience, we have grown to become one of the UK's leading social housing providers. Citizen owns and manages 30,000 homes for diverse communities across the West Midlands, from urban tower blocks to rural villages and towns.

    Our Hereford & Worcester Neighbourhood's team manage around 4,000 customer homes within Herefordshire, Worcestershire, Gloucestershire and Warwickshire.

    Role: Neighbourhood Officer

    Salary: £37,595

    Position: Permanent Full time Position, 37 hours per week

    Location: Hereford & Worcester / Hybrid working

    As Neighbourhood Officer, you will be responsible for the tenancy management of a patch within a geographical area.

    The team is very friendly and welcoming and works well together. The team support each other with workloads and arrange joint visits on request. The team are very supportive with new members of staff and will often arrange on the job training, shadowing of colleagues and patch visits.

    In housing you can make a real difference, the role of Neighbourhood Officer will involve:

    Overseeing tenancy management and estate issues.
    Dealing with Anti-Social behaviour from minor reports to serious cases and actively be involved in multi - agency work to resolve issues.
    Dealing with sensitive safeguarding matters
    Carrying our regular block and estate inspections.
    Involvement in the management of new build properties for all tenancy management issues.
    Conducting tenancy reviews for all properties within the allocated patch
    Reviewing service charges and depreciationAs Neighbourhood Officer, we need you to have:

    Ability to carry out interviews to discuss sensitive customer issues
    Excellent I.T Skills
    Ability to develop successful professional relationships with partners to achieve positive outcomes
    Willingness and ability to work flexibly and to attend meetings and other events outside normal business hours to meet the needs of the service
    Ability to adapt positively to change, be resilient to challenges, obstacles, and handling conflict
    Highly self-motivated, able to act with integrity and show drive and enthusiasm
    Current driving licence and access to a carWe would be excited if you have:
